A leading supply chain technology provider in Greater London is seeking a skilled individual to lead the design and refinement of compensation frameworks aligned with corporate strategy.
Responsibilities include:
- Budgeting
- Designing performance-based incentives
- Providing strategic insights through data analysis
A proven track record in compensation system design and cross-functional collaboration is critical. The role offers a unique opportunity to shape equitable pay structures and enhance talent retention within a global organization.
